"""
Tasks API endpoints
Provides task metadata, episode management, and source file access for the debug-env benchmark.
"""
import logging
from typing import Any, Dict, List
from fastapi import APIRouter, HTTPException, status, Depends
from pydantic import ValidationError
from sqlalchemy.orm import Session
from debug_env.server.tasks.data import get_available_task_ids, get_task_by_id, validate_task_id
from debug_env.server.tasks.loader import TaskLoader
from debug_env.server.database.db import get_db
from debug_env.server.database.managers.task_manager import get_task_manager
from debug_env.server.schemas.task_schemas import (
TaskListResponse,
TaskResponse,
EpisodeResponse,
EpisodeListResponse,
EpisodeCreateRequest,
EpisodePatchRequest,
)
logger = logging.getLogger(__name__)
router = APIRouter(prefix="/tasks", tags=["tasks"])
def _format_validation_error(e: ValidationError) -> str:
"""Format a Pydantic ValidationError into a human-readable string."""
messages = []
for error in e.errors():
field = " -> ".join(str(loc) for loc in error["loc"])
messages.append(f"{field}: {error['msg']}")
return "Validation failed: " + "; ".join(messages)
@router.get("", response_model=Dict[str, Any])
async def list_tasks(
db: Session = Depends(get_db),
maxResults: int = 50,
pageToken: str = None,
syncToken: str = None,
):
"""
Returns metadata for all available debug tasks with pagination support.
Query Parameters:
- maxResults: Maximum tasks per page (default: 50)
- pageToken: Pagination token from previous response
- syncToken: Sync token for incremental updates
GET /tasks
"""
try:
# Get user_id from header (default to "default_user" if not provided)
user_id = "default_user"
# Use TaskManager for listing with pagination
manager = get_task_manager(db, user_id)
response = manager.list_tasks(
max_results=maxResults,
page_token=pageToken,
sync_token=syncToken,
)
# Convert to dict response matching schema
return {
"etag": response.etag,
"items": [TaskResponse.model_validate(item).model_dump() for item in response.items],
"nextPageToken": response.nextPageToken,
"nextSyncToken": response.nextSyncToken,
}
except ValueError as e:
logger.error(f"Validation error listing tasks: {e}")
raise HTTPException(
status_code=status.HTTP_400_BAD_REQUEST,
detail=str(e),
)
except Exception as e:
logger.error(f"Error listing tasks: {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while listing tasks",
)
@router.get("/{taskId}", response_model=Dict[str, Any])
async def get_task(taskId: str):
"""
Returns metadata for a specific debug task.
GET /tasks/{taskId}
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found. Available: {get_available_task_ids()}",
)
task = get_task_by_id(taskId)
logger.info(f"Retrieved task metadata for '{taskId}'")
return task
except HTTPException:
raise
except ValidationError as e:
# Handle unexpected schema validation errors
logger.error(f"Schema validation error for task '{taskId}': {e}")
raise HTTPException(
status_code=status.HTTP_400_BAD_REQUEST,
detail=_format_validation_error(e),
)
except Exception as e:
logger.error(f"Error getting task '{taskId}': {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while retrieving task",
)
@router.get("/{taskId}/files", response_model=List[str])
async def list_task_files(taskId: str):
"""
Returns the list of editable source files for a task (excludes test files).
GET /tasks/{taskId}/files
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found. Available: {get_available_task_ids()}",
)
files = TaskLoader.list_source_files(taskId)
logger.info(f"Listed {len(files)} source files for task '{taskId}'")
return files
except HTTPException:
raise
except ValueError as e:
# Handle business logic validation errors (invalid task ID)
logger.error(f"Validation error listing files for task '{taskId}': {e}")
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ail="Invalid task or request parameters")
except FileNotFoundError as e:
# Task is registered but files are missing from disk
logger.error(f"Task files missing on disk for '{taskId}': {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while listing task files",
)
except Exception as e:
logger.error(f"Error listing files for task '{taskId}': {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while listing task files",
)
@router.get("/{taskId}/files/{filename}", response_model=Dict[str, str])
async def get_task_file(taskId: str, filename: str):
"""
Returns the canonical (pre-episode) content of a source file.
Use this to inspect the original broken code before starting an episode.
During an episode, use the read_file tool via POST /step instead.
GET /tasks/{taskId}/files/{filename}
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found. Available: {get_available_task_ids()}",
)
content = TaskLoader.read_source_file(taskId, filename)
logger.info(f"Read source file '{filename}' for task '{taskId}'")
return {"task_id": taskId, "filename": filename, "content": content}
except HTTPException:
raise
except ValueError as e:
# Handle business logic validation errors (invalid filename, path traversal)
logger.error(f"Validation error reading file '{filename}' for task '{taskId}': {e}")
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ail="Invalid filename or request parameters")
except FileNotFoundError as e:
# File not found within the task
raise HTTPException(status_code=status.HTTP_404_NOT_FOUND, detail=str(e))
except Exception as e:
logger.error(f"Error reading file '{filename}' for task '{taskId}': {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while reading task file",
)
# ── Episode Management Endpoints ───────────────────────────────────────────
@router.post("/{taskId}/episodes", response_model=Dict[str, Any])
async def create_episode(
taskId: str,
db: Session = Depends(get_db),
):
"""
Create a new episode (task run) for the current user.
POST /tasks/{taskId}/episodes
Returns:
- id: Episode identifier (uuid4)
- task_id: Task identifier
- status: "active"
- workdir: Path to working directory with task files
- etag: Cache validation tag
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found",
)
user_id = "default_user"
manager = get_task_manager(db, user_id)
# Load task files into temp directory
workdir = TaskLoader.load(taskId)
# Create episode record
episode = manager.create_episode(taskId, workdir)
logger.info(f"Created episode {episode.id} for task {taskId}")
return EpisodeResponse.model_validate(episode).model_dump()
except HTTPException:
raise
except ValueError as e:
logger.error(f"Validation error creating episode for task {taskId}: {e}")
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ail=str(e))
except Exception as e:
logger.error(f"Error creating episode for task {taskId}: {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while creating episode",
)
@router.get("/{taskId}/episodes", response_model=Dict[str, Any])
async def list_episodes(
taskId: str,
db: Session = Depends(get_db),
maxResults: int = 50,
pageToken: str = None,
):
"""
List episodes for a task with pagination.
GET /tasks/{taskId}/episodes
Query Parameters:
- maxResults: Maximum episodes per page (default: 50)
- pageToken: Pagination token from previous response
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found",
)
user_id = "default_user"
manager = get_task_manager(db, user_id)
response = manager.list_episodes(taskId, max_results=maxResults, page_token=pageToken)
return {
"items": [EpisodeResponse.model_validate(item).model_dump() for item in response.items],
"nextPageToken": response.nextPageToken,
}
except HTTPException:
raise
except ValueError as e:
logger.error(f"Validation error listing episodes for task {taskId}: {e}")
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ail=str(e))
except Exception as e:
logger.error(f"Error listing episodes for task {taskId}: {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while listing episodes",
)
@router.get("/{taskId}/episodes/{episodeId}", response_model=Dict[str, Any])
async def get_episode(
taskId: str,
episodeId: str,
db: Session = Depends(get_db),
):
"""
Retrieve a specific episode.
GET /tasks/{taskId}/episodes/{episodeId}
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found",
)
user_id = "default_user"
manager = get_task_manager(db, user_id)
episode = manager.get_episode(taskId, episodeId)
if not episode:
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Episode '{episodeId}' not found for task '{taskId}'",
)
return EpisodeResponse.model_validate(episode).model_dump()
except HTTPException:
raise
except Exception as e:
logger.error(f"Error retrieving episode {episodeId} for task {taskId}: {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while retrieving episode",
)
@router.patch("/{taskId}/episodes/{episodeId}", response_model=Dict[str, Any])
async def update_episode(
taskId: str,
episodeId: str,
request: EpisodePatchRequest,
db: Session = Depends(get_db),
):
"""
Update an episode's status and/or pass_rate.
PATCH /tasks/{taskId}/episodes/{episodeId}
Request Body:
- status: Optional, new status ("active", "passed", "failed", "abandoned")
- pass_rate: Optional, pass rate (0.0-1.0)
"""
try:
if not validate_task_id(taskId):
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Task '{taskId}' not found",
)
user_id = "default_user"
manager = get_task_manager(db, user_id)
# Get current episode
episode = manager.get_episode(taskId, episodeId)
if not episode:
raise HTTPException(
status_code=status.HTTP_404_NOT_FOUND,
detail=f"Episode '{episodeId}' not found for task '{taskId}'",
)
# Update with provided fields
status = request.status if request.status else episode.status
pass_rate = request.pass_rate if request.pass_rate is not None else episode.pass_rate
updated_episode = manager.update_episode(taskId, episodeId, status, pass_rate)
logger.info(f"Updated episode {episodeId} for task {taskId}")
return EpisodeResponse.model_validate(updated_episode).model_dump()
except HTTPException:
raise
except ValueError as e:
logger.error(f"Validation error updating episode {episodeId}: {e}")
raise HTTPException(status_code=status.HTTP_400_BAD_REQUEST, detail=str(e))
except Exception as e:
logger.error(f"Error updating episode {episodeId}: {e}")
raise HTTPException(
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
detail="Internal server error occurred while updating episode",
)
